Most coffee produced in Ethiopia is grown by many small holders and purchased and processed by large washing stations. This process, although necessary in Ethiopia, obscures the provenance of the cherries. Gesha Village changes that, only processing cherry they grow, on their 471 hectare farm. This particular lot is from the Surma block and is the 1931 Gesha Varietal. Expect notes of Florals, Berries, Tropical fruits.
